The hidden risks of LLM autonomy

Large language models (LLMs) have come a long way from the once passive and simple chatbots that could respond to basic user prompts or look up the internet to generate content. Today, they can access databases and business applications, interact with external systems to independently execute complex tasks and make business decisions. This transformation is primarily supported by emerging interoperability standards, such as the Model Context Protocol (MCP) and Agent-to-Agent (A2A) communication. Rethinking governance in a decentralized identity world

Decentralized identity (DID) is gaining traction, and for CISOs, it’s becoming a part of long-term planning around data protection, privacy, and control. As more organizations experiment with verifiable credentials and self-sovereign identity models, a question emerges: Who governs the system when no single entity holds the reins? The governance gap Traditional identity systems come with built-in governance. Central authorities validate users, issue credentials, and set policies for revocation and auditing.
